Levi Roosevelt Taylor, 27, of Lolo, MT passed away on Sunday August 7th, 2016. He was born March 1st, 1988 to Mary and Jim Taylor becoming the 4th child to complete their family.  As a child he grew up in Florence and Lolo, Mt where he made many friends and continues to graduate from Big Sky High School in 2006. From an early age he discovered his love for cars, motorcycle’s, snowmobiles, anything with horse power or anything that he could ride a wheelie on, (where is your helmet?), wreck or “Slap some 24’s on it!” If you were to see Levi, it was usually driving down the street wanting to race you or a friendly wave of his “deuces” out the window to let you know he saw you.  He enjoyed spending time with his family, teaching his daughter to be a rider as well as his nephew, Tristan.  He loved music, fishing, mountains and everything about the outdoors. Levi’s personality and laugh were contagious. He was the original jokester and always knew how to put a smile on everyone’s face.

On November 27th, 2009 the light to his eyes was born to him and Rachel Messerschmidt.  From that moment on “Wee-bye” was determined to make her a jokester and a spitting image of him, which she continues to be to this day. Levi and Rachel shared many laughs together but went on to discover more in life.

On Nov. 1, 2015 he married the love of his life Stevie Taylor. The couple started a business together and resided in Lolo. Stevie and Levi could make cheeks and stomach hurt when they were together. They loved every moment together and made many memories together in the short time they were married.
